Name:Babbacombe Cliff Railway

Summary

Early 20th century funicular railway - inclined plane - linking Babbacombe Downs with Oddicombe Beach below.

Full description

Torbay HER record (SMR record). SDV361984.

From 1890 a cliff railway was mooted to connect the downs to the beach, Sir George Newnes having offered to construct one, but opposition was so strong that the local authority at the the time, the St Marychurch Local Board (subsumed into The borough of Torquay in 1900), refused him. Repeated attempts over the next three decades were made to promote the work. In February 1923 it was announced that the Tramway Company would build in time for the 1924 season, though completion had to wait until 1926. [1]

Access to the railway is by path from Cliffside Road to the north and Babbacombe Downs Road to the south. The horizontal travel is over 200m, the vertical over 80m to sea level at Oddicombe Beach.
